Advisory
Please avoid the area of 70th St and Alvarado Rd due to traffic collision.
Please avoid the area of 70th St and Alvarado Rd due to traffic collision. 
Please avoid the area of 70th St and Alvarado Rd due to traffic collision.
Address/Location
City of La Mesa
8130 Allison Ave
La Mesa, CA 91942
Contact
Emergency: 9-1-1
Non-emergencies: 619-463-6611